Hebrew semantic word

אבד

8 lexical sense(s); 184 exact STEP occurrence token(s).

Lexical senses and semantic domains

Sense 1: to be lost

= state of not being located in the place where it is expected to be

Sense 2: to wander, to stray

= action by which someone does not stay in a single expected location but moves about from place to place without a clear destination

Sense 3: to give up as lost

= action by which someone decides to stop searching for an object that is not located in its expected place

Sense 4: to vanish, to disappear, to be lost, to perish, to be broken, to be destroyed, to be ruined

= process by which humans or objects disappear or are removed from existence;◄ either by (a usually unnatural) death, aggression, hardship, disaster, natural processes, acts of destruction, or direct divine intervention

Sense 5: to destroy, to kill

= causative action by which humans or deities remove (other) humans or objects from existence; ◄ by (a usually unnatural) death, aggression, hardship, disaster, destruction, or direct divine intervention; ► often as punishment

Sense 6: to perish, to come to an end

= process by which an event comes to an end, usually under unfavorable circumstances

Sense 7: to destroy, to corrupt, to put an end

= action by which someone brings an event to an end, usually under unfavorable circumstances

Sense 8: to destroy a life > to kill people

literally: to destroy a life; hence: = action by which someone causes another person to die a violent death
